Liga Si.mobil Vodafone 1995/1996: final table of First division
# | Club | M | W | D | L | Goal | Pts | GD | Result |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
1 | HIT Gorica | 36 | 18 | 13 | 5 | 49 - 22 | 67 | +27 | Champion (Champions League) | |
2 | NK Olimpija Ljubljana | 36 | 19 | 7 | 10 | 79 - 39 | 64 | +40 | Vice-champion und Cup winner (CWC) | |
3 | Mura | 36 | 15 | 13 | 8 | 43 - 29 | 58 | +14 | UEFA Cup | |
4 | Maribor Branik | 36 | 14 | 11 | 11 | 47 - 32 | 53 | +15 | Intertoto Cup | |
5 | CMC Publikum | 36 | 13 | 12 | 11 | 62 - 47 | 51 | +15 | ||
6 | NK Beltinci | 36 | 13 | 11 | 12 | 41 - 40 | 50 | +1 | ||
7 | Rudar Velenje | 36 | 13 | 10 | 13 | 46 - 37 | 49 | +9 | ||
8 | NK Primorje | 36 | 13 | 9 | 14 | 56 - 48 | 48 | +8 | ||
9 | Nova Oprema KS Prevalje | 36 | 11 | 9 | 16 | 44 - 46 | 42 | -2 | Relegation Playoff | |
10 | MNK Izola | 36 | 1 | 5 | 30 | 13 - 140 | 8 | -127 | Relegated | |
Pts = Points M = Matches played; W = Matches won; D = Matches drawn; L = Matches lost; GD = Goal difference; | ||||||||||
